WSYY-FM (94.9 FM) is a radio station broadcasting an Adult Hits/Full-Service format (from 5:00AM through 11:15PM ET). Playing a mix of Classic Rock, Oldies, Contemporary Pop Music and Today's Hot New Country, the station broadcasts for approximately 18¼ hours per day. The Mountain 94.9 also carries the complete schedule of Red Sox Baseball and local high school sports in season. Licensed to Millinocket, Maine, USA, the station's broadcast signal serves the Central Penobscot County, Eastern Piscataquis County and Southern Aroostook County Maine areas, and the station is licensed to service the town of Millinocket, Maine, the very town where its Studios/Offices and Transmitter Tower Site are all located within. The station is currently owned by Katahdin Communications, Inc. and features programing from CBS Radio. WSYY-FM originally went on the air in 1978 on 97.7 FM as WKTR, upgrading to its current facilities in 1984 on 94.9. It's an affiliate of the Floydian Slip syndicated Pink Floyd program, one of the two Maine affiliates—apart from WLOB—of When Radio Was (7 days a week from 10:00PM through 11:00PM ET), and is Maine's only affiliate of the Crook & Chase syndicated country music countdown programming (Sunday afternoons from 2:00PM through 6:00PM ET).
